The Coordinator of Research and Evaluation is responsible for coordinating all data collection, research, and Federal reporting in
support of a multi-campus grant project funded by the United States Department of Labor. Under the supervision of the Senior Director of
Research and Analysis and in collaboration with participating institutions, the incumbent will design and coordinate research
strategies, collect, analyze, and validate data, and complete reporting to ensure compliance with all Federal reporting requirements. The
incumbent will also respond to ad-hoc requests to assess progress toward meeting project goals and objectives as well as to inform project
activities and planning.
Classification: Full-time, Non-Classified, Exempt, Benefits-Eligible, Grant Funded.
Funding for this position has been secured through at least September 30, 2026.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
This position serves as the project lead for all research and reporting activities
related to supporting a multi-campus project funded by the United States Department of Labor. This involves collaboration with participating
institutions, agency personnel, and an external evaluator to collect, analyze, report, and utilize data to gauge the success of the
grand-funded project.
